• Sat. Nov 23rd, 2024

Как тестировать веб-сайт: основные виды, цели и этапы тестирования

ByMarkus Bauer

Apr 6, 2023

Что, если объединить подходы пользовательского тестирования и тщательного контроля качества? Детальнее о UX-подходе вы можете узнать в этом полезном материале нашего блога. Основная задача состоит в том, чтобы выявить самые слабые места, тестирование верстки сайта которые могут привести к потере данных или нарушению работы системы. Для этого обычно имитируют атаку вредоносного источника, а затем устраняют найденные угрозы. Для повышения производительности сайта также имеет значение размер элементов контента.

В чем состоит важность и необходимость тестирования сайта

Перед началом наблюдения важно объяснить пользователю цель исследования, как оно будет проводиться и какую роль он играет. Важно подчеркнуть, что исследователь не дает оценку его личным способностям, а следит за тем, как работает продукт, чтобы понять, что можно улучшить. Иногда невозможно провести наблюдение в естественной среде из-за ограниченного доступа или отсутствия такой возможности. В таких случаях важно, чтобы оборудование и настройки программного обеспечения максимально соответствовали условиям рабочего места пользователя.

На что обращать внимание при тестировании обеспечения качества

В противном случае вы не можете быть уверены, какая из них ответственна за изменения в производительности. Если тест не пройден, вы, конечно, потеряли 192 доллара, но теперь вы можете сделать следующий тест A/B еще более полезным. Если этот второй тест удвоит коэффициент конверсии вашего блога, вы в конечном итоге потратили $ 284, чтобы потенциально удвоить доход вашей компании. Независимо от того, сколько раз ваш A/B тест не пройден, его конечный успех почти всегда перевесит затраты на его проведение.

Какие бывают этапы тестирования сайтов электронной коммерции?

Современные тенденции и веб-приложения кардинально изменили процесс создания кода. В этой статье отобрано 10 интересных веб-приложений для тестирования кода в Интернете. Все эти приложения требуют подключения к Интернету и некоторые из более продвинутых редакторов предлагают еще профессиональные планы. Но большинство из этих инструментов наверняка пригодятся, когда вы будете пытаться отладить блок JavaScript или PHP.

☆ Что такое юзабилити-тестирование сайта?

  • Иногда кнопку размещают в месте, где ее сложно найти, иногда интерактивные элементы сайта сделаны настолько непонятными, что пользователь не захочет даже связываться с ними.
  • Что хорошего в их приложении, так это то, что вы можете быстро отлаживать множество разных языков программирования на одной странице.
  • Это удобно; это экономит время и нервы; это то, что выберет покупатель.
  • Структура мобильных устройств значительно отличается от структуры браузеров для мобильных версий сайта.
  • Расходы на его ремонт постоянно растут, но машина все равно может подвести в любой момент.
  • А если у сайта уже есть пользователи, то тестировщикам понадобится аналитика его трафика.

Теперь мы можем рассмотрим SQL Fiddle, который работает таким же образом, за исключением синтаксиса базы данных SQL. IDE One – это еще один инструмент, основанный на глубоком программировании и разработке программного обеспечения. Их онлайн-редактор поддерживает подсветку синтаксиса для некоторых очень известных языков. К ним относятся Objective-C, Java, C #, VB.NET, SQL и десятки других. WebMaker – это игровая площадка для HTML, CSS, JavaScript, а также препроцессора, такого как Sass, LESS и JSX. WebMaker автоматически скомпилирует синтаксис этих препроцессоров, чтобы браузер правильно отображал код.

как тестировать сайт

Когда необходимо делать QA и QC тестирование сайта?

После чего QA-инженер вправе разработать собственный план тестирования с обязательным выполнением всех этапов, описанных ниже. Плохой контроль качества вызывает две глобальные проблемы, связанные с высоким риском. Исследование функционала — это яркий пример проверки на «ожидание — реальность». Специалист выясняет, насколько реализованные функции соответствуют всем требованиям, прописанным в ТЗ, спецификациях, различных документах и просто тому, что ожидает получить клиент. Именно поэтому абсолютно любой продукт нуждается в качественной проверке, после которой можно выдохнуть с облегчением и смело запускать ресурс в сеть. Тестировщик программного обеспечения — это волшебник, который знает, как сделать так, чтобы ваш сайт не стал героем рубрики «ожидание — реальность».

QA инженер должен проверить, насколько корректно будет работать приложение с подобными важными функциями на различных мобильных устройствах. Первое, что видит клиент при переходе на сайт — главная или домашняя страница. Здесь должна отображаться информация о продуктах, услугах, поддержке клиентов и призыв к действию с целевой кнопкой. Также на этой странице важно предоставить доступ пользователям к подробной информации о компании (странице “О нас”), карте сайта (удобной навигации), политике конфиденциальности и контактам. Каждая опция на сайте должна выполнять свою функцию — открывать форму, переходить на нужную страницу, отправлять в корзину и прочее. Главная функция, которую нужно протестировать в мобильной версии сайта, — оформление заказа покупателями.

как тестировать сайт

Это приложения, озвучивающие пользователю то, что происходит на экране. Поскольку проблемы со зрением являются одной из самых распространенных во всем мире, то становится критически необходимым использование скринридеров при тестировании. Было обнаружено, что летом электрик не мог использовать планшет из-за высокой температуры в помещении, что приводило к его периодическому отключению. При работе на открытом воздухе планшет попадал под прямые солнечные лучи, создавая блики, что мешало выполнению задач.

Завершающая часть отчета содержит выводы, а при необходимости могут быть предложены рекомендации по улучшению сайта. Для того чтобы результаты тестирования были полезными и эффективными, важно проверить, действительно ли выявлены те проблемы, которые стали основой для проведения исследования. Мы с вами разобрались, как можно тестировать юзабилити ресурса. Осталось ответить на вопрос, как использовать полученные результаты. По завершении тестирования обычно создается обобщенный отчет о проделанной работе.

Затем вы протестируете эти две версии, показав каждой из них определенный процент посетителей сайта. В идеале, процент посетителей, видящих ту или иную версию, одинаков. То, что работает для одной компании, может не обязательно работать для другой.

Пользователи записывают в дневник когда и при каких обстоятельствах они думали о разрабатываемом продукте. Несколько пользователей и модератор собираются для обсуждения идей по дизайну и архитектуре сайта. С помощью инструментов опроса можно собирать сведения от своих пользователей в тот момент, когда они совершали определенные действия на странице. Преимущество – возможность исследовать пользовательскую проблему в режиме реального времени, но недостатком является предвзятость и упрощение. При такой проверке пользователь выполняет поставленные задачи в отношении продукта или услуги, в то время как исследователь или модератор наблюдает за ним в режиме реального времени. Такой анализ – это изучение использования продукта с реальными людьми, работающими с ним.

Браузерные расширения, которые могут влиять на внешний вид приложения (например, AdBlock) — пробуем включить и отключить. Появление курсора — довольно часто мы забываем проверить, появляется ли вообще и как выглядит курсор в полях ввода, на кликабельных элементах. Пользовательские формы могут являться потенциальной мишенью угрозы. Сомневаетесь при выборе профессии между программистом и тестировщиком? Читайте нашу статью и узнайте, какая профессия подходит именно вам и как начать свой путь в этой увлекательной отрасли. А вот такое распределение показано в уровнях заработной платы тестировщиков по городам Украины.

Интерпретация полученных данных — это весьма субъективный процесс, впрочем, как и сама оценка веб-ресурса пользователем. Не факт, что вам не придется запускать тестирование еще и еще раз. Однако такой подход позволяет проверить на практике, эффективны ли ваши решения. Если в работе находятся разные версии сайта (десктопная и мобильная), то лучше проводить юзабилити тестирование отдельно.

Цель тестирования — повысить производительность мобильного сайта до максимума. Чем быстрее будут загружаться все элементы страниц в различных браузерах и на всевозможных устройствах, тем лучше. Отметим, что иногда ТЗ для работы qa engineer для quality control или quality assurance может отличаться в зависимости от модели бизнеса (B2B или B2C). Стратегия работы с различными видами потребителей (компаниями или частными клиентами) может иметь отличия в требованиях к акцентам работы мобильной версии сайта. Перейдем непосредственно к листу, которым должен пользоваться в своей работе qa инженер.

IT курсы онлайн от лучших специалистов в своей отросли https://deveducation.com/ here.